Why It Matters

The dunes may look tough, but they’re fragile. A tossed can, a broken strap, or a food wrapper left behind doesn’t just ruin the view—it can damage machines, injure riders, and harm wildlife. Even worse, trash on the sand gives fuel to those who want to shut our playgrounds down.

Roost Strong, Respect the Sand

The dunes belong to all of us, and it’s on every rider to do their part

           Keep a trash bag in your rig or backpack.

           Leave your camp spotless before you roll out.

            If you see it, scoop it—whether it’s yours or not.
